Field force physics
noun. the region of space surrounding a body, such as a charged particle or a magnet, within which it can exert a force on another similar body not in contact with it. See also electric field, magnetic field, gravitational field.

Is gravity a field force?
A gravitational field is a type of force field and is analogous to electric and magnetic fields for electrically charged particles and magnets, respectively. There are two ways of showing the gravitational field around an object: with arrows and with field lines.

Is mass a field force?
All objects with mass have a gravitational field around them. A gravitational field is where a mass experiences a force. All matter has a gravitational field that attracts other objects. The more mass an object has, the greater its gravitational field will be.

Why is gravitational force a field force?
In physics, a gravitational field is a model used to explain the influences that a massive body extends into the space around itself, producing a force on another massive body. Thus, a gravitational field is used to explain gravitational phenomena, and is measured in newtons per kilogram (N/kg).

What is the most powerful force in the universe?
The strong nuclear force, also called the strong nuclear interaction, is the strongest of the four fundamental forces of nature. It's 6 thousand trillion trillion trillion (that's 39 zeroes after 6!) times stronger than the force of gravity, according to the HyperPhysics website (opens in new tab).
